3D-Printed iPhone 5 Cases Available for Order Ahead of Apple Event
Sep 11th 2012, 13:03

The launch of the next-generation iPhone is still a day away, but manufacturers are already working hard on developing Apple accessories.

Paris-based 3D-printing accessory company Sculpteo will be accepting orders for iPhone 5 cases hours before the official Apple event on Wednesday, where the company is expected to launch its next-generation smartphone.

From choosing a design which incorporates anything from social networking profile pictures to text, the company has set up a page for Apple fans to get creative with designing a new case. Apple fans can also customize and create their own iPhone 5 case via Sculpteo's website and free app [iTunes link].
